アプリに追加されているプラグインの設定情報を変更する

目次

caution
警告

このページで説明しているAPIは、開発を検討中のAPIです。

アップデートオプション内の「開発中の新機能」から動作をお試しいただけます。
設定方法は、 新機能の有効/無効の切り替え手順 (External link) を参照してください。

APIに関するフィードバックを、ユースケースとともに、 kintone の改善に協力する (External link) フォームへぜひご登録ください。

フィードバックの例
  • 「APIラボで提供されているAPIを早く本番環境で利用したい」
  • 「こういう用途で使うために、このようなAPIを提供してほしい」

アプリに追加されているプラグインの設定情報を変更する

アプリに追加されているプラグインの設定情報を変更します。

利用するには開発中の新機能の「アプリに追加されているプラグインの設定情報を取得または更新するREST API」を有効にしてください。

URL

通常のアプリ
https://sample.cybozu.com/k/v1/preview/app/plugin/config.json
ゲストスペースのアプリ
https://sample.cybozu.com/k/guest/ゲストスペース ID/v1/preview/app/plugin/config.json

HTTP メソッド

PUT

必要なアクセス権

  • アプリ管理権限

リクエスト

パラメーター
パラメーター名 必須 説明
app 数値または文字列 必須 アプリ ID
id 文字列 必須 プラグイン ID
config オブジェクト 必須 プラグイン の設定情報
キーと値の文字列を対にしたオブジェクトの形式で指定してください。
例:
{
"key1": "value1",
"key2": "value2"
}
リクエストの例
ヘッダー
1
2
3
4
{
  "X-Cybozu-Authorization": "QWRtaW5pc3RyYXRvcjpjeWJvenU=",
  "Content-Type": "application/json"
}

リクエストヘッダーの詳細は kintone REST API の共通仕様 を参照してください。

ボディ
1
2
3
4
5
6
7
8
{
   "app": 1,
   "id": "djmhffjhfgmebgnmcggopedaofckljlj",
   "config": {
      "key1": "value1",
      "key2": "value2"
   }
}

レスポンス

プロパティ
プロパティ名 説明
revision 文字列 アプリの設定を変更したあとのリビジョン番号